Why Banana Peel and Onion Work Together
Banana peel may seem like kitchen waste, but it’s packed with antioxidants like lutein, vitamin C, and polyphenols. These compounds are known to fight oxidative stress, a major factor in premature aging of the skin. The peel also has natural moisturizing properties, making it soothing for dryness and roughness.
Onions, on the other hand, are rich in sulfur compounds, quercetin, and vitamin C. These nutrients are linked to collagen production, skin repair, and improved circulation. Together, banana peel and onion create a blend that supports both protection and renewal—two key pillars of anti-aging care.

How to Prepare and Use the Remedy
Method 1: Simple Rubbing
- Take a fresh banana peel and gently rub the inner side on your face or hands.
- Apply a few drops of fresh onion juice afterward.
- Leave on for 15 minutes, then rinse with lukewarm water.
Method 2: Banana-Onion Paste
- Blend a small piece of banana peel with one tablespoon of onion juice.
- Apply as a mask to your face or hands.
- Let it sit for 20 minutes before washing off with mild soap and water.
Method 3: Overnight Hand Treatment
- Mix mashed banana peel with onion juice.
- Massage onto hands before bed, then wear cotton gloves overnight.
- Wash off in the morning and apply moisturizer.
Practical tip: Always do a patch test before applying to larger areas. Some people may find onion juice too strong; diluting with aloe vera gel or honey can reduce irritation.

Safety Tips and Best Practices
- Patch test first: Apply on a small area to check for any reaction.
- Avoid sensitive areas: Onion juice may sting near the eyes or on broken skin.
- Consistency matters: Natural remedies take time, so regular use over weeks is key.
- Complement with lifestyle: Hydration, a balanced diet, and sun protection remain the foundation of healthy, youthful skin.
